September Prompts:

1. Go someplace you can sit and listen, maybe a café or mall, maybe a bench by the lake… you choose. Close your eyes and listen for a few minutes. Try to identify the sounds you hear. Then write about what you noticed.

2. Rachel Field wrote a poem in which she said, “something told the wild geese that it was time to go…” Use this line as a prompt for a story, a poem, or an article.
